On Tuesday, 9 October 2012 11:46:53 UTC+2, Wim Deblauwe wrote: > > Hi, > > I recently updated from 1.2.141 to 1.3.168 because I needed support for > .... > > However, when I did this, one of my unit tests started failing. I managed > to extract this into a small test program (see bottom of this email). When > using version 1.2.141, the 2nd query returns the single row that is present > in the database. However, just switching to version 1.3.168 makes it fail > and returns no rows. The > changelog<http://www.h2database.com/html/changelog.html>only contains > information up to version 1.3.159, so it was impossible for > me to check all the changes notes to see if something might have changed in > date handling.
